Flaming River FR1746DD Billet-Joint 1"-DD X 3/4"-30 Steering U-Joint is what I used on my 1998. I bought it via Amazon.

Borgeson 015231 1" DD x 3/4"-30 Steering U-Joint appears to be similar, for less cost.

What does the DD in 1" DD stand for? I ASSume Dxxx diameter.

double D is the shape of the shaft. Sorta like an oval with two flats, it is not a splined shaft.

3/4 -30 would be a splined shaft 3/4" dia. with 30 splines.
